Rehaki (Kala) - Seloo, Wardha

Rehaki (Kala) is a village situated in the Seloo tehsil of Wardha district, Maharashtra. It is located approximately 4 km from the tehsil headquarters in Seloo and around 22 km from the district headquarters in Wardha. Rehaki serves as the Gram Panchayat for Rehaki (Kala) village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Rehaki (Kala) is 533957. The village covers a total geographical area of 426.49 hectares and falls under the 442104 pincode. Wardha is the nearest town, located about 22 km away.

Rehaki (Kala) village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Wardha Assembly and Parliamentary constituency.

Population of Rehaki (Kala)

As per Census 2011, Rehaki (Kala) village has a total population of 2,621 people, consisting of 1,344 males and 1,277 females. The village has 619 households and a sex ratio of 950 females per 1,000 males. There are 235 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 2,080 literate and 541 illiterate residents. Additionally, 325 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 185 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Rehaki (Kala)

Rehaki (Kala) is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Seloo Road, while the nearest airport is Dr. Babasaheb Ambedkar International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 39.1 km.
